Espace développeurs · SDK & intégration
Intégrez VeriChap KYCdans vos front-ends web, mobiles et back-offices.
Nos SDKs et guides d'intégration vous permettent de déployer rapidement des parcours KYC complets : capture de document, selfie, messages d'erreur, success, consentement, et compatibilité mobile, tout en gardant le contrôle sur votre design et vos règles métier.
Cas d'usage typiques
Les SDKs VeriChap KYC couvrent les scénarios d'onboarding client, d'activation de services, de remédiation KYC périodique et de réactivation de comptes dormants, à grande échelle.
- 💳Ouverture de compte
- 📲Wallet & mobile money
- 🏦Banque & microfinance
- 🛡️Renouvellement KYC
Vous gardez le contrôle sur la navigation, le branding et les messages, tout en bénéficiant des mêmes contrôles KYC que la console conformité.
SDK Web (React / Next.js)
Intégrez des étapes KYC complètes dans vos flux React ou Next.js : capture de document, selfie, messages d'erreur, et gestion des états de chargement, sans réinventer toute l'expérience front.
Exemple d'intégration React
import { VerichapKycFlow } from "@verichap-kyc/react";
export default function OnboardingKyc() {
return (
<VerichapKycFlow
apiKey={process.env.NEXT_PUBLIC_VERICHAP_PUBLISHABLE_KEY}
environment="sandbox"
reference="KYC-CLIENT-12345"
onCompleted={(result) => {
// Enregistrer la décision côté backend
console.log("KYC terminé", result);
}}
/>
);
}Bonnes pratiques front
- • Utiliser des clés publishable côté front.
- • Conserver la logique métier & la persistance côté backend.
- • Gérer les erreurs réseau et les interruptions utilisateur.
- • Loguer l'ID de vérification dans vos systèmes internes.
SDKs mobiles (iOS & Android)
Les SDKs mobiles fournissent des écrans prêts à l'emploi pour la capture de document, le selfie, la détection de vivacité et la gestion des erreurs réseau, tout en respectant vos guidelines d'accessibilité et de localisation.
iOS (Swift / SwiftUI)
Module embarqué compatible avec les versions récentes d'iOS, supportant dark mode et internationalisation.
Android (Kotlin)
Composants Material, gestion des permissions caméra & stockage, et compatibilité avec vos architectures existantes.
Frameworks hybrides
Intégration possible via WebView sécurisée ou plugins (React Native, Flutter, etc.) selon votre architecture.
Intégration back-office & consoles conformité
Au-delà des parcours utilisateurs, vous pouvez intégrer les données KYC et les décisions dans vos propres back-offices conformité, outils internes ou CRM, grâce à l'API et aux webhooks.
Vue dossiers & décisions
Récupérez les décisions, scores, commentaires et journaux d'audit pour enrichir votre console conformité existante.
Exports & reporting
Utilisez nos endpoints d'export ou webhooks dédiés pour alimenter vos data warehouses, outils BI ou SIEM.
Exemple de flux d'intégration complet
- 1. L'utilisateur démarre un parcours d'onboarding dans votre app.
- 2. Votre back-end crée une vérification via l'API VeriChap.
- 3. Le front lance le SDK (web ou mobile) avec la référence fournie.
- 4. À la fin du flux, le SDK notifie votre app locale et les webhooks envoient l'événement final.
- 5. Votre back-end met à jour le compte client et vos outils internes (core banking, CRM, etc.).
